Some Telecom customers are getting slower broadband speeds despite the company's move to promised faster "unconstrained" speeds.

A telecom watchdog group and competitors say it is a result of low investment in the Telecom network.

In publicity for its October launch of unconstrained broadband, Telecom said that its "blazing speeds" would be "powering their way into Xtra's new Go Large" plans.......www.nzherald.co.nz
